NORTHEAST PLASTIC SURGERY CENTER LLC is a surgeon located in OLD LYME, CT. NPPES has assigned the NPI number 1932586682 to NORTHEAST PLASTIC SURGERY CENTER LLC on May 01, 2015. It is a Type-2 NPI, indicating this NPI number is associated with an organization. The primary taxonomy selected by this provider is 2086S0122X from the Health Care Provider Taxonomy code set, which is classified as Surgery, specializing in Plastic and Reconstructive Surgery

A taxonomy code is a code that describes the health care service provider's type, classification, and the area of specialization. The primary specialty for this provider is indicated as (Primary) below.

The taxonomy codes are selected by the provider at the time of NPI registration. Selection of a taxonomy code does not replace any credentialing or validation process that the provider requesting the code should complete.
